WNAV, Eye On Annapolis, and Arundel News Network will be co-sponsoring one of the final debates for Anne Arundel County Executive on Friday. We'd love to have you tune in for a listen, but more importantly, we want to know what's on your mind and what you want to know.  So we are soliciting questions that we can ask the candidates. 

Details:

When:  Friday, October 17th - 2pm to 3pm
Where: WNAV-1430AM Studios

On Friday, Dr. Dan Nataf, Barbara Cox and I will be live in the WNAV studios with Delegate Steve Schuh and Colonel George Johnson for one of the final debates between the two candidates for Anne Arundel County Executive.

The debate will be from 2pm to 3pm and will be done live (wish me luck) and streamed online. But we need your help with some of the questions.

All topics are open for discussion, and we will be selecting as many as possible to ask the candidates. My suggestion is to challenge them both. Steer clear of the topics that have been beat into the ground at every other forum or debate--school funding, public safety, regional transportation, affordable housing, etc. Come up with something specific and actionable if elected.
